Changes coming for Potter's Ace Hardware, new owners

(June 1, 2022) - Retail for Potter’s started as a small grocery store in Jamestown in 1946 and has grown into a network of 21 Ace Hardware and Home Center locations in Middle Tennessee and Southern Kentucky. Potter’s Ace provides competitive prices, quality products, and Helpful Service to homeowners, do-it yourselfers, and contractors to help customers fix it, build it, or maintain it.

As Potter’s prepares for the future, it has entered into a strategic partnership with a company from Dallas, Texas, who plans to bring together up to 150 Ace Hardware locations into one group of Ace Hardware retailers under the name Bolster Hardware, LLC. This move will allow the Potter’s locations to continue business as usual while implementing new technology and new Ace programs such as Ace Rewards and Instant Savings to provide added value for their customers. In addition, the plan will be to make considerable investment into improving the locations through remodels and renovations to help the Potter’s locations be the best in class when it comes to Ace Hardware and Home Center locations. The goal is to be the best place to work and the best place to shop.

Potter’s Ace appreciates all their valued customers and although this process will involve a change in ownership, the key employees, management, and the mission to offer service, value, and convenience in all the communities where Potter’s is located will remain the same.

As co-founder of Potter’s Ace Brandon Smith noted, “The name of our stores will remain the same and it is business as usual for our stores, our employees, and our customers. This is a strategic move for us that will allow us to continue to improve our stores and remain relevant in the Hardware and Home Improvement industry. We appreciate all our customers and look forward to continuing to serve them into the future.”
